4. Instrucciones de funcionamiento
4.1 Controles e indicadores del panel frontal

Figura 4.1: Frente en ángulo view of the QSC RMX1450a Stereo Power Amplifier, showing the power switch, channel gain controls, and LED indicators.
- Interruptor de alimentación: Alterna el ampEncendido y apagado del elevador.
- Gain Controls (Channel 1 & 2): Front-mounted rotary controls for adjusting the input sensitivity (volume) of each channel.
- LED de señal: Illuminate when an audio signal is present at the input.
- LED de clip: Illuminate when the output signal is approaching clipping (distortion). Reduce gain if these LEDs light frequently.
4.2 Rear Panel Switches
The rear panel features several switches to configure the amplifier's operation:
- Clip Limiters: Independent and defeatable clip limiters prevent severe clipping and protect speakers. It is generally recommended to keep these engaged.
- Filtros: High-pass filters (e.g., 30 Hz or 50 Hz) can be engaged to remove unwanted low-frequency content, protecting speakers and improving clarity.
- Interruptores de modo:
- Stereo: Default mode, each channel operates independently.
- Paralelo: Both channels receive the same input signal, but drive separate speakers. Useful for bi-amping or driving multiple speakers with a mono source.
- Mono puente: Combines both channels into a single, higher-power mono output. Use only with speakers rated for bridged operation and connect to the designated bridged output terminals.

6. Solución de problemas
If you encounter issues with your RMX1450a amplifier, consulte los siguientes pasos comunes de solución de problemas:
| Problema | Posible causa | Solución |
|---|---|---|
| Sin poder | Power cord disconnected, faulty outlet, tripped circuit breaker | Check power cord connection, try a different outlet, reset circuit breaker. |
| No hay salida de sonido | Input cables disconnected, speaker cables disconnected, gain controls at minimum, incorrect mode setting, source device off | Verify all cable connections, increase gain, check rear panel mode switches, ensure audio source is active. |
| Sonido distorsionado | Señal de entrada demasiado alta, amplifier clipping, faulty speaker, incorrect impedance match | Reduce input level from source, lower amplifier gain, check Clip LEDs, inspect speakers, verify speaker impedance. |
| Calentamiento excesivo | Blocked ventilation, excessive load, prolonged high output | Ensure clear airflow around the unit, reduce output level, check speaker impedance. Allow unit to cool down. |
